Manford Origin and Meaning
The name Manford is a boy's name.
Manford is a masculine name with English origins, derived from an Old English place name meaning 'common ford' or 'shared river crossing.' The name combines 'man' (common or shared) with 'ford' (river crossing). While never extremely popular, Manford saw modest use in the United States during the early-to-mid 20th century, particularly in rural communities. The name has a sturdy, traditional quality that reflects its Anglo-Saxon heritage. Manford has declined in usage in recent decades, now considered a rare vintage name that might appeal to parents looking for a distinctive yet historically-rooted option with a connection to nature and geography.
